在HTML页面上“干净地显示”JSON代码

时间:2014-02-24 21:34:28

标签: javascript html json

我正在尝试将此代码更清晰,它会显示在html页面上。

app.get("/web/users", function(req, res) {
var users = app.models.users.model('User');
users.find({}).lean().exec(function(err, result){
res.write(JSON.stringify(result));
res.end();

这确实有用,它列出了这样的东西......

[{ “_编码”: “... ”“ 姓名 ”:“ 贾斯汀”, “PHONENUMBER”: “5555555555”, “useSMS”:真 “来电”:[” ... “],” PIN “:” ...“}]

现在,我希望此代码显示如下......

Justin 5555555555

1 个答案:

答案 0 :(得分:2)

如果我理解正确并且你想要你的json漂亮印刷,请点击这里:

res.write(JSON.stringify(result, null, 2));

这将使用2个空格分层缩进您的JSON。

编辑:重新阅读Mouseroot的评论,我认为你真正想要的是:

res.write(result.name + ' ' + result.phonenumber);